Jarmilidae
Taxonomy
Jarmilidae was named by Demoulin (1970). Its type is Jarmila.
It was assigned to Protereismatoidea by Hubbard and Kukalová-Peck (1980); and to Ephemeroptera by Carpenter (1992).
